Nearly 60,000 people read the Worcester News every day – and that figure keeps on growing.

That’s the finding of the latest audit into the size of our audience. Independent auditors Jicreg measure readership of the paper plus the online audience to provide an accurate measure of the total number of people reading the paper’s content each day.

The latest figures have just been released in the Jicreg October report and show that on any day the combined print and website audience is 57,588. The weekly readership figure is 78,159.

The largest number of readers still get their news and information from the paper, with nearly 60,000 readers a week.

However, online is growing fast, and a third of our audience is now viewing us purely online.

These figures do not include the hundreds of people who subscribe to the Worcester News’ page-turning e-edition via their PC, laptop, iPhone, iPad, Android phone or on our new Kindle Fire service.

Berrow’s Worcester Journal, which shares the Worcester News website but has its own e-edition, has a total audience of 115,394 a week – 60,000 readers of the paper and 55,000 online. Editor Peter John said: “Reports of the death of newspapers are premature.

These figures show how a huge swathe of the population seek out local news and information from a source they trust – their local newspaper.

“It isn’t a case of paper or website. The Worcester News is now a media company – providing local news, sport, information, opinion and advertising in a wide variety of ways that most suit individual needs.

“We provide news via the paper, our website, Face-book, Twitter, apps and e-editions. It’s the combination of print and online that makes us a powerful voice in and on behalf of our communities.”
